I know they discourage making reservations, then changing the names later. I haven't done it since they started requiring ALL names/ages of your party ahead of time.

However, I will have a reservation later this year that I can't use, and want to give/sell it to a friend. Are they going to give me a hard time, or should I just not worry about it.

They say they require all the names upfront. But frequently, this is not possible, as the relatives and friends joining the gang may change, but you still want to secure the reservation first. I frequently only give my name first, and add the other names as it get closer to check-in.

how do you do that. I'm always told I need 1 different name on each ressie. If I have 5 studios I needed 5 different names and addresses and ph # . I do this every yr and they won't let me use my name on more than 1 room.
 
how do you do that. I'm always told I need 1 different name on each ressie. If I have 5 studios I needed 5 different names and addresses and ph # . I do this every yr and they won't let me use my name on more than 1 room.

I think she is probably talking about booking just the one room and adding the other guests later to that same room.

If you are booking 5 rooms, you have to have a different person as lead on each one. Disney will not allow someone to be lead on more than one at the same time.
